ALT Linux Bugzilla
– Attachment 5052 Details for
Bug 25926
Ошибка в файлах FindQt3.cmake и FindQt4.cmake
New bug
|
Search
|
[?]
|
Help
Register
|
Log In
[x]
|
Forgot Password
Login:
[x]
|
EN
|
RU
[patch]
Патч модулей (исправленный)
cmake.patch (text/plain), 2.95 KB, created by
serpiph
on 2011-08-20 10:45:17 MSK
(
hide
)
Description:
Патч модулей (исправленный)
Filename:
MIME Type:
Creator:
serpiph
Created:
2011-08-20 10:45:17 MSK
Size:
2.95 KB
patch
obsolete
>diff -Naur cmake-2.8.5.orig/Modules/FindPackageHandleStandardArgs.cmake cmake-2.8.5/Modules/FindPackageHandleStandardArgs.cmake >--- cmake-2.8.5.orig/Modules/FindPackageHandleStandardArgs.cmake 2011-07-08 15:12:50.000000000 +0400 >+++ cmake-2.8.5/Modules/FindPackageHandleStandardArgs.cmake 2011-08-20 10:40:56.011831597 +0400 >@@ -211,7 +211,7 @@ > SET(VERSION_MSG "Found unsuitable version \"${VERSION}\", but required is at least \"${${_NAME}_FIND_VERSION}\"") > SET(VERSION_OK FALSE) > ELSE ("${${_NAME}_FIND_VERSION}" VERSION_GREATER "${VERSION}") >- SET(VERSION_MSG "(found suitable version \"${VERSION}\", required is \"${${_NAME}_FIND_VERSION}\")") >+ SET(VERSION_MSG "(found suitable version \"${VERSION}\", minimum required is \"${${_NAME}_FIND_VERSION}\")") > ENDIF ("${${_NAME}_FIND_VERSION}" VERSION_GREATER "${VERSION}") > ENDIF(${_NAME}_FIND_VERSION_EXACT) > >diff -Naur cmake-2.8.5.orig/Modules/FindQt3.cmake cmake-2.8.5/Modules/FindQt3.cmake >--- cmake-2.8.5.orig/Modules/FindQt3.cmake 2011-07-08 15:12:50.000000000 +0400 >+++ cmake-2.8.5/Modules/FindQt3.cmake 2011-08-20 10:41:52.195645357 +0400 >@@ -206,7 +206,7 @@ > ENDIF (NOT req_qt_major_vers) > > STRING(REGEX REPLACE "([0-9]+)\\.[0-9]+\\.[0-9]+" "\\1" req_qt_major_vers "${QT_MIN_VERSION}") >- STRING(REGEX REPLACE "[0-9]+\\.([0-9])+\\.[0-9]+" "\\1" req_qt_minor_vers "${QT_MIN_VERSION}") >+ STRING(REGEX REPLACE "[0-9]+\\.([0-9]+)\\.[0-9]+" "\\1" req_qt_minor_vers "${QT_MIN_VERSION}") > STRING(REGEX REPLACE "[0-9]+\\.[0-9]+\\.([0-9]+)" "\\1" req_qt_patch_vers "${QT_MIN_VERSION}") > > # req = "6.5.4", qt = "3.2.1" >diff -Naur cmake-2.8.5.orig/Modules/FindQt4.cmake cmake-2.8.5/Modules/FindQt4.cmake >--- cmake-2.8.5.orig/Modules/FindQt4.cmake 2011-07-08 15:12:50.000000000 +0400 >+++ cmake-2.8.5/Modules/FindQt4.cmake 2011-08-20 10:43:54.200005474 +0400 >@@ -1122,7 +1122,7 @@ > > # set version variables > STRING(REGEX REPLACE "^([0-9]+)\\.[0-9]+\\.[0-9]+.*" "\\1" QT_VERSION_MAJOR "${QTVERSION}") >- STRING(REGEX REPLACE "^[0-9]+\\.([0-9])+\\.[0-9]+.*" "\\1" QT_VERSION_MINOR "${QTVERSION}") >+ STRING(REGEX REPLACE "^[0-9]+\\.([0-9]+)\\.[0-9]+.*" "\\1" QT_VERSION_MINOR "${QTVERSION}") > STRING(REGEX REPLACE "^[0-9]+\\.[0-9]+\\.([0-9]+).*" "\\1" QT_VERSION_PATCH "${QTVERSION}") > > ENDIF(QT_QMAKE_EXECUTABLE AND QTVERSION) >@@ -1130,6 +1130,11 @@ > #support old QT_MIN_VERSION if set, but not if version is supplied by find_package() > IF(NOT Qt4_FIND_VERSION AND QT_MIN_VERSION) > SET(Qt4_FIND_VERSION ${QT_MIN_VERSION}) >+ STRING(REGEX REPLACE "^([0-9]+)\\.[0-9]+\\.[0-9]+.*" "\\1" Qt4_FIND_VERSION_MAJOR "${QT_MIN_VERSION}") >+ STRING(REGEX REPLACE "^[0-9]+\\.([0-9]+)\\.[0-9]+.*" "\\1" Qt4_FIND_VERSION_MINOR "${QT_MIN_VERSION}") >+ STRING(REGEX REPLACE "^[0-9]+\\.[0-9]+\\.([0-9]+).*" "\\1" Qt4_FIND_VERSION_PATCH "${QT_MIN_VERSION}") >+ SET(Qt4_FIND_VERSION_TWEAK "0") >+ SET(Qt4_FIND_VERSION_COUNT "3") > ENDIF(NOT Qt4_FIND_VERSION AND QT_MIN_VERSION) > > IF( Qt4_FIND_COMPONENTS )
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 25926
:
5014
|
5019
| 5052